The fig above illustrates five types of data bursts used for various control and traffic bursts.

  • Normal bursts are used for both TCH and DCCH transmissions on both forward and reverse link.
  • FCCH and SCH bursts are used inn TS 0 of specific frames to broadcast the frequency and time synchronisation control messages on the forward link.
  • RACH burst is used by all mobiles to access service from any base station
  • The dummy burst is used as filler information for unused time slots on the forward link
